Observed each year on March 01, Baby Sleep Day promotes Awareness about the essential role of healthy infant rest. This World initiative encourages families to prioritize structured sleep routines. Experts share Educational resources that explain circadian rhythms and early brain development. Quality sleep strengthens emotional stability. It also supports long-term Mental Health and cognitive growth. Parents learn practical strategies, from consistent bedtime rituals to calming environments. Communities host workshops and digital campaigns to expand outreach. Through informed guidance and collective engagement, the day underscores how restorative sleep nurtures resilience, enhances parental confidence, and lays a stable foundation for lifelong well-being.
